CloudShell package to assist with creating Apps.
Project description
cloudshell-app-helper
File Location: cloudshell/helpers/app_import, cloudshell/helpers/save_workflow
-
save_app_info_orch.py
- save_app_deployment_info
- Creates a 'DeployInfo' object of deployment info for each App in a Sandbox and saves each to the Sandbox Data
- save_app_deployment_info
-
deploy_info.py
- DeployInfo
- Serializable Data structure to hold the app templated deployment info and is passed to the Sandbox Data
- DeployInfo
-
save_app_utility.py
-
save_flow
- Will verify that deployment info for this app was saved to the Sandbox Data
- Will verify that a display image can be gathered from url or existing template, uses default image if not
- Attempts to run the hidden 'save_app' command from the cloud provider.
- Gather deployed app attributes
- Create the App XML and upload
-
save_flow_just_app
- Will verify that deployment info for this app was saved to the Sandbox Data
- Will verify that a display image can be gathered from url or existing template, uses default image if not
- Gather deployed app attributes
- Create the App XML and upload
-
-
build_app_xml.py
- app_template
- Takes app deployment info, app resource info and cloud provider info as input
- Returns the formatted app xml
- app_template
-
upload_app_xml.py
- upload_app_to_cloudshell
- Creates a full blueprint package with the app xml within
- Utilizes Quali API to upload the package
- upload_app_to_cloudshell
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distributions
Close
Hashes for cloudshell-app-helper-2.0.1.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| 608b297dca703295aca764d699d450ba0e6375b182d425c2cbfca4354e9c857a |
|
MD5 | 6ff140773d441c3f1ab48fb00fedb19d |
|
BLAKE2b-256 | 8d8aab8e4ca0ba05c7be2f24c2c6148bf95c730edcd488b63a4291c98b77f0fc |
Close
Hashes for cloudshell_app_helper-2.0.1-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 18a338ff7cd4c92282601f0fea5488b563d88d73ba8125759a2156e90a5a4469 |
|
MD5 | 59014dcf4584cd685b9ccdc0c2020d58 |
|
BLAKE2b-256 | 4f77fd51a1670c102a18611e4fb7d085eabaff0f4d4d78656d539274611a17c3 |
Close
Hashes for cloudshell_app_helper-2.0.1-py2-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| dce9526a7c7ef14f2700a86ce1b3891f83cb741f2fee038a0316f7bb53e1b9ca |
|
MD5 | 431d3e5632a0b2e107f196da92622905 |
|
BLAKE2b-256 | f46ddb5f3ba9f3ac66b1cd4d82e14c16ff61e4211bff804bac36f4af3363eb81 |